Backend engineer with 10 years of experience building reliable, scalable systems. For the last 4 years I’ve specialized in Ruby on Rails and Infrastructure, and over the past 8 months I’ve been working in Python with Strands Agents, building AI agents and pushing forward agentic software.
Experience
2022 — Now
2022 — Now
Denver, Colorado, United States
2021 — 2022
2021 — 2022
Denver, Colorado, United States
At CirrusMD I co-led a research effort on using tools such as Mirth to integrate with other healthcare applications. Integrated our web application with Health Gorilla using their FHIR R4 APIs for easy data sharing to an HIE clearing house. Moved our developer documentation from a 3rd party hosted site to GitHub pages providing cost savings for the company. Participate in a hackathon integrating Slack to our application which allowed patients to talk to providers from an application of their choice. Worked with a small team doing patent research and building cases for potential patents for our application.
Languages/Frameworks/Tools: Ruby on Rails, Redis, JavaScript (Rhino) for Mirth, Java for Mirth, Postgres, AWS
Extra learning: Attend RubyConf 2021 to get more integrated with the Ruby community. Reading books such as Effective Testing with RSpec 3 and Practical Object-Oriented Design. Started to delve into the React world for front end development. As well as some venturing into Go.
2021 — 2021
2021 — 2021
Denver, Colorado, United States
Languages: Java / JavaScript
Frameworks/Applications: Mirth
Databases: MSSQL / Postgres
Major Contributions:
Built a custom Java library to integrate an application called Mirth into Git (utilizing the JGit Java library, for version control in Azure DeOps. Integrated Azure Repos into Slack for management and devs to have visibility into the repositories for commits, pull requests, and merges. Build documentation and processes for Mirth within Azure DevOps.
2018 — 2021
2018 — 2021
Indianapolis, Indiana Area
At Marathon Health I manage the design and implementation of our central Mirth Connect (NextGen Connect) engine, which acts as an Enterprise Service Bus, to connect various healthcare vendors utilizing a REST API architecture with the programming languages Java and Rhino JavaScript framework. I also assist in Salesforce technical architecture and provide APEX coding when needed.
• Duties
Collaborate with team members on technical business goals
Architect and develop REST API integrations with various API clients
Create Visio diagrams of proposed and implemented API solutions
Investigate new technologies to plug into our ecosystem (MuleSoft and new API clients to integrate with)
• Tools Utilized
Mirth (NextGen) Connect v3.x.x
AWS (S3, EC2, RDS, AmazonMQ, and Lambda)
• Languages
Java
JavaScript (Rhino framework)
APEX
Python as needed
• API Clients
Athena (using Athena propriety and FHIR API endpoints)
Salesforce
OurHealth portal
Limeade
Regenstrief Loinc
MDScripts
• Database
PostgreSQL
2016 — 2018
2016 — 2018
Franklin, TN
I started my career with Community Health Systems providing support for HIM Applications as well as implementing Product/Project Management tactics for transcription based applications with Nuance, M*Modal, Carestream, and several other vendors. After a year working with Community Health Systems, I transitioned to the HL7 Integration team to further my knowledge in hospital workflow by providing support for both Mirth Connect and Rhapsody HL7 interfaces as well as development in both Mirth and Rhapsody. I collaborated with several different teams and team members daily in assuring proper support on HL7 interface issues are being addressed. Areas of work:
• Mirth Connect/Rhapsody Interfaces
• Design and develop Mirth and Rhapsody interface filters, transformers, and channels using JavaScript, XML, JSON, and SQL.
• Experience with FTP/SFTP, RESTful API, SOAP, TCP/IP
• HL7 v2 and FHIR (DSTU2/STU3) messaging types
• Design and develop v2 to FHIR mappers utilized in Mirth
• Develop and maintain our PHIN-MS environment utilizing Mirth and 3rd party applications (Develop and maintain C# utilities as well as developing Python scripts)
• PostgreSQL, Microsoft SQL Server, MongoDB
• AS/400 systems
• Develop documentation for support, projects, and processes
• Develop run-books for projects and processes
• Work independently as well as collaboratively with little supervision
• Coordinate with physicians and local IT on resolving incidents
• Successfully ran and implemented 6 projects while under the HIM Product Support team
• Built/Implemented automation techniques for server management (Utilized PowerShell scripts within Task Scheduler for server maintenance)
• Built server monitoring setups utilizing Total Network Monitor for our Nuance Dragon product
• Assisted with M*Modal Products
• Assisted with Nuance Products and server administration including SQL server administration
Education
Motlow State Community College
Associate of Science (A.S.)
2013 — 2016